A spectrum of SN 2010fv (CBET #2351) was obtained using the Low
Resolution Imaging Spectrometer (LRIS; Oke et al. 1995, PASP, 107, 375)
on the Keck-1 10-m telescope on July 8 UT, revealing the supernova to be
of type II.
